The Role

Reporting into a senior sustainability leader, you’ll be responsible for managing and evolving the environmental compliance framework, ensuring all regulatory, permitting, and planning obligations are met while preparing the organisation for future requirements.

Key Responsibilities
  • Leading and developing the environmental compliance strategy with internal teams, tenants, and external regulators
  • Acting as a subject matter expert on current and emerging environmental regulation and planning conditions
  • Partnering closely with Legal, Projects, Estates and Technical Services to embed compliance across the business
  • Managing ISO14001 and ISO50001 management systems, including internal and third-party audits
  • Overseeing compliance linked to water, ground contamination, air quality, waste and emissions
  • Managing environmental permits, trade effluent consents and discharge compliance, including investigations and action plans
  • Supporting climate adaptation planning and operational responses to physical climate risks
  • Playing a key role in infrastructure upgrade projects, particularly drainage and utilities
  • Streamlining environmental reporting and feeding risks into the wider governance process
  • Supporting wider sustainability and responsible business initiatives as needed
